Best Walking Routes in Fairy Stone State Park
Stuart's Knob Trail is a 0.7 mile (1,500-step) route located near Stuart, Virginia. This route has an elevation gain of about 98.4 ft and is rated as easy. Find the best walking trails near you in Pacer App.
Whiskey Run Trail is a 1.4 mile (3,000-step) route located near Stuart, Virginia. This route has an elevation gain of about 49.2 ft and is rated as easy. Find the best walking trails near you in Pacer App.
Little Mountain Falls Trail is a 3.2 mile (7,500-step) route located near Stuart, Virginia. This route has an elevation gain of about 160.7 ft and is rated as easy. Find the best walking trails near you in Pacer App.

What is the best season to walk in Fairy Stone State Park?
The best season to walk in Fairy Stone State Park is typically spring or fall when the weather is mild and the foliage is vibrant.
What are the typical weather conditions to prepare for in Fairy Stone State Park?
Visitors to Fairy Stone State Park should prepare for a variety of weather conditions. Summers are warm and humid, while winters can be cold with occasional snow. It's important to check the weather forecast before visiting and dress accordingly.
What kind of wildlife might you encounter in Fairy Stone State Park?
Fairy Stone State Park is home to a diverse range of wildlife, including white-tailed deer, wild turkeys, various songbirds, and small mammals. Visitors may also encounter reptiles such as snakes and lizards, so it's important to be mindful of your surroundings while hiking.
